jnxIkeTunnelTable
The IKE tunnel table (jnxIkeTunnelTable), whose object identifier is {jnxIPSecPhaseOne 1}, is used to monitor the IKE security associations established with the remote peers. The MIB variables in this table are used to display the IKE SA attributes and the SA statistics. There is one entry for each IKE SA present.
The key for this table is the combination of a service set name, remote gateway address, and the IKE tunnel index. The service set name is used from the jnxSpSvcSetTable which is implemented as part of the Services PIC MIB. The SNMP manager uses the jnxSpSvcSetTable to get the service set name and this information can then be used to query the jnxIkeTunnelTable for the given service set.
To get only IKE tunnels specific to a particular remote gateway in a service set, the SNMP manager can specify the corresponding service set name and the remote gateway address in the query.
The jnxIkeTunnelEntry, whose object identifier is {jnxIkeTunnelTable 1}, has 25 objects, which are listed in Table 99. Each entry contains attributes associated with an active IPsec phase 1 IKE tunnel.
Table 99: jnxIkeTunnelTable
Object | Object Identifier | Description |
---|---|---|
jnxIkeTunIndex | jnxIkeTunnelEntry 1 | Index for the table. The value of the index is a number that begins at 1 and is incremented with each tunnel that is created. When the index number reaches 2,147,483,647 the value wraps back to 1. |
jnxIkeTunLocalRole | jnxIkeTunnelEntry 2 | The role of the local peer identity. The role can be initiator or responder. |
jnxIkeTunNegState | jnxIkeTunnelEntry 3 | The state of the current negotiation. The state can be matured or non matured. |
jnxIkeTunInitiatorCookie | jnxIkeTunnelEntry 4 | Cookie generated by the peer that initiated the IKE phase 1 negotiation. This cookie is carried in the ISAKMP header. |
jnxIkeTunResponderCookie | jnxIkeTunnelEntry 5 | Cookie generated by the peer responding to the IKE phase 1 negotiation. This cookie is carried in the ISAKMP header. |
jnxIkeTunLocalIdType | jnxIkeTunnelEntry 6 | The type of local peer identity. A local peer can be identified by an IP address, a fully qualified domain name (FQDN), or a distinguished name. |
jnxIkeTunLocalIdValue | jnxIkeTunnelEntry 7 | The value of the local peer identity.
|
jnxIkeTunLocalGwAddrType | jnxIkeTunnelEntry 8 | The IP address type of the local endpoint (gateway) for the IPsec phase 1 IKE tunnel. |
jnxIkeTunLocalGwAddr | jnxIkeTunnelEntry 9 | The IP address of the local endpoint (gateway) for the IPsec phase 1 IKE tunnel. |
jnxIkeTunLocalCertName | jnxIkeTunnelEntry 10 | The name of the certificate used for authentication of the local tunnel endpoint. This object has a valid value only if the negotiated IKE authentication method is something other than a preshared key. If the IKE negotiation does not use certificates for authentication, the value is NULL. |
jnxIkeTunRemoteIdType | jnxIkeTunnelEntry 11 | The type of remote peer identity. A remote peer can be identified by an IP address, an FQDN, or a distinguished name. |
jnxIkeTunRemoteIdValue | jnxIkeTunnelEntry 12 | The value of the remote peer identity.
|
jnxIkeTunRemoteGwAddrType | jnxIkeTunnelEntry 13 | The IP address type of the remote gateway (endpoint) for the IPsec phase 1 IKE tunnel. |
jnxIkeTunRemoteGwAddr | jnxIkeTunnelEntry 14 | The IP address of the remote gateway (endpoint) for the IPsec phase 1 IKE tunnel. |
jnxIkeTunNegoMode | jnxIkeTunnelEntry 15 | The negotiation mode of the IPsec phase 1 IKE tunnel. |
jnxIkeTunDiffHellmanGrp | jnxIkeTunnelEntry 16 | The Diffie Hellman Group used in IPsec phase 1 IKE negotiations. |
jnxIkeTunEncryptAlgo | jnxIkeTunnelEntry 17 | The encryption algorithm used in IPsec phase 1 IKE negotiations. |
jnxIkeTunHashAlgo | jnxIkeTunnelEntry 18 | The hash algorithm used in IPsec phase 1 IKE negotiations. |
jnxIkeTunAuthMethod | jnxIkeTunnelEntry 19 | The authentication method used in IPsec phase 1 IKE negotiations. |
jnxIkeTunLifeTime | jnxIkeTunnelEntry 20 | The negotiated lifetime (in seconds) of the IPsec phase 1 IKE tunnel. |
jnxIkeTunActiveTime | jnxIkeTunnelEntry 21 | The length of time (in hundredths of seconds) that the IPsec phase 1 IKE tunnel has been active. |
jnxIkeTunInOctets | jnxIkeTunnelEntry 22 | The total number of octets received by this IPsec phase 1 IKE security association. |
jnxIkeTunInPkts | jnxIkeTunnelEntry 23 | The total number of packets received by this IPsec phase 1 IKE security association. |
jnxIkeTunOutOcets | jnxIkeTunnelEntry 24 | The total number of octets sent by this IPsec phase 1 IKE security association. |
jnxIkeTunOutPkts | jnxIkeTunnelEntry 25 | The total number of octets sent by this IPsec phase 1 IKE security association. |
